  1. Did you know that in MLB your pension vests after just 43 days on the active roster? In the NBA and NFL it takes 3 full years. Not bad for a league that supposedly doesn't look out for the lower and middle tier players.

  20. Ownership simply doesn't give a s***. Denver is a transplant town and they have a great ballpark downtown. Between the transplants, the visiting fans (the Rockies actually advertise to other MLB fanbases), and the Denver people who just want to drink outside, they still have very good attendance. 13th in MLB this year despite sucking so bad. Ownership has also bought and developed a ton of property surrounding the ballpark and makes a killing off of all of that. The owner actually does spend a little on MLB payroll, but he hates spending on front office and player development. He's even on record saying that a salary cap should apply to those budgets. He always hires in house and they run a skeleton front office. He becomes friends with the front office people and the players and won't get rid of people because he's friends with them. I think he just promoted his 35 year old son to run the team. MLB puts up with it because he often leads negotiations during the CBA and is good cannon fodder to provide cover for the rest of the owners.
